Birth Karen Brody
Birth
Karen Brody
Birth is a documentary-style play based on interviews playwright KarenBrody conducted with mothers across America. It tells the true birth stories of eightwomen painting a portrait of how low-risk, educated women are giving birth today. Since 2006 the play been performed around the world as part ofBOLD, an arts-based global movement inspiring communities to create childbirth choices that work for mothers. This edition of the book includes the entire play, playwright's reflections, and the impact the play has had on BOLD communities. It also includes a foreword by Christiane Northrup, MD, FACOG, a well-known authority on women's health and wellness.
